THE HEALTH DANGERS OF ASBESTOS
Asbestos when it's left untouched doesn't carry any health risks. It's only when you damage or cut it in any way that it can release its harmful particles or fibres into the surrounding atmosphere. When these fibres find their way into lungs through breathing, they can sometimes cause a health condition called, asbestosis. Evidence also indicates that certain asbestos-related conditions, such as mesothelioma, pleural thickening, and lung cancer, can develop after inhaling such fibres or particles.
There's no cure for asbestosis & the lung tissue scarring caused by the particles cannot be reversed or treated.
Symptoms for asbestosis could include:
- Pain in the Shoulders or Chest
- Persistent Cough
- Severe Shortness of Breath
- Extreme Fatigue
- Wheezing
Previous asbestos exposure over a long period of time, together with the first signs of these symptoms, should speedily be followed up with a visit to your local GP practise. This issue needs immediate attention & shouldn't be ignored
CONSIDERATIONS WHEN YOU'RE DEALING WITH ASBESTOS
Although brown and blue asbestos underwent a ban in the British Isles in 1985, white asbestos (chrysotile) remained legal and was widely used in buildings until a complete ban was put in place in 1999. Those owning properties built over this period of time should be cautious when remodeling or doing any structural works because of the increased probability of stumbling upon asbestos. From pipe lagging & textured coatings to boiler insulation & ceiling tiles, asbestos had many applications, while it was also used in spray form to capitalise on its insulation and fire protection qualities.
You shouldn't worry that there is any immediate danger if some asbestos-containing materials have been identified in your home in the Sandiway area. It's only through disturbing or damaging asbestos-containing materials that a potential health hazard can occur. There are certain cases whereby it might be better to leave the asbestos in situ, making certain it's not damaged or disturbed. If you are at all uncertain or would like to know about safe ways to deal with asbestos in your property you should get in touch with a certified asbestos removal company in Sandiway for advice & guidance.
Although all asbestos products must be handled with an appropriate level of care, some asbestos-containing materials can present a higher risk to health than others. As a consequence of how various asbestos products are produced & their likelihood of releasing fibres into the environment, products like pipe lagging, loose fill cavity insulations & asbestos insulation boards are higher risk to health than roofing panels and asbestos cement sheets. A safe & appropriate procedure for the removal of asbestos from your home will be organised by an authorised Sandiway asbestos removal contractor.
The HSE or the local authority will have to be advised by the contractor if licensed asbestos removal work needs to be done, according to the type of premises and what they are being used for. Any work concerning asbestos needs to comply with the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012 (CAR 2012), with proper controls put in place to prevent or minimise exposure to asbestos fibres and dust.
Be warned it's an offence punishable by law to perform anything regarded to be licensed work without having a license.
DISPOSAL OF ASBESTOS
Following removal from your residential or commercial property in Sandiway, any material that contains asbestos becomes hazardous waste. Any waste that is regarded as hazardous has to be disposed of in line with strict requirements, with asbestos-containing waste requiring extremely responsible handling, transportation and disposal. A competent asbestos removal contractor in Sandiway will conform to all regulations & guidelines provided by the local authority and the Health & Safety Executive.
For asbestos that's damaged or that's made up of loose-fibre material, its disposal will be subject to the requirements of the CDG 2009 (Carriage of Dangerous Goods Act). For safe transportation of these hazardous materials, a waste carrier's license is necessary & the waste can only be processed in a government authorised hazardous waste centre. For peace of mind the use of a registered Sandiway asbestos removal firm will give them the obligation to follow all legislation & rules, including the keeping of all operations and disposal paperwork for 3 years, at least in case it's needed afterwards.
THE WORK PHASES
Before any actual work starts on removing any suspect items from your Sandiway home or property you'll need to confirm if it is asbestos. Only a registered asbestos surveyor or contractor can legally establish asbestos and the techniques required for its removal & disposal. You might decide not to undertake an asbestos survey on your house or property, but if it was constructed between the years 1945 and 1999, you need to presume there is in fact asbestos present somewhere & observe all health & safety measures.
An asbestos removal contractor can recommend a surveyor to examine your premises, but this individual should be independent & not employed by or a partner in the enterprise.
If the survey unearths asbestos materials that require a certified firm for removal and disposal, the Health and Safety Executive must be advised at least fourteen days prior to the starting of work. The appropriate documentation will be provided by the asbestos removal contractor and will include: 1. A written work report of the legislation, guidelines and regulations for the assignment. 2. A method of intent for the asbestos testing, as well as the methods of clearing up the work site after completion using the 4 stages of clearances. 3. All medical certificates, hazardous waste disposal training & testing, work licenses and risk assessments for the work in question. 4. As soon as the 4 stages of clearances have been met, the Certificate of Reoccupation from an accredited organisation will be presented.
All PPE (personal protective equipment) required by the workers will be provided by the asbestos removal contractor itself, which will also make sure that all waste that is produced is correctly secured and transported to the disposal facility, (which has to be government authorised).
PROFESSIONAL BODIES, AFFILIATIONS and QUALIFICATIONS
Before you decide on an asbestos removal company in the Sandiway area, confirm their affiliation and membership of professional bodies and associations within the asbestos field.
ARCA - The Asbestos Removal Contractors Association is Britain's premier professional body representing companies working within the asbestos sector. Supplying an extensive package of guidance, training and support, ARCA has taken responsibility for the promotion of safe working practices, professionalism and reliability for its membership.
ATaC - The Asbestos Testing and Consultancy Association is the de-facto professional organisation for surveyors, analysts and testing laboratories, examining all substances believed to contain asbestos. ATaC is a certified UKAS partner and offers recognition for its members in this specialised industry.
UKATA - The UK Asbestos Training Association (UKATA), is a not for profit body which provides the finest quality training for the asbestos sector at all levels. From homeowners to industry leaders, it offers instantly recognisable qualifications that can be verified and checked by means of their online search facility.

There are 2 main categories of asbestos survey carried out on buildings in Sandiway.
- Asbestos Management Surveys
- Asbestos Refurbishment and Demolition Surveys
Asbestos Management Surveys Sandiway: The purpose of an Asbestos Management Survey in Sandiway is to keep track of asbestos containing materials (ACMs) during normal use and occupation of a building. No harm should come to occupants when asbestos containing materials (ACMs) remain in good condition and undisturbed. But, when they're damaged, disturbed or in bad condition asbestos fibres can be released into the surrounding environment, causing a potentially dangerous situation. The requirement for these surveys applies to any non-domestic buildings, or shared areas of residential buildings in Sandiway which were built before the year 2000.
Asbestos Refurbishment/Demolition Surveys Sandiway: When plans are afoot for demolishing or restoring a building or premises in Sandiway, an Asbestos Refurbishment and Demolition Survey will be necessary. In most cases ARD surveys are conducted on Sandiway buildings which are vacant or unoccupied, because a considerable amount of damage can be inflicted by this type of survey. Where upgrading, refurbishment or demolition is planned an ARD survey must be carried out before any of this work commences. This will find any asbestos containing materials that exist within the structure of the building and work out how to remove or safely manage these materials. Organising these surveys is a responsibility of occupants, management agents and professionals engaged in these refits and renovations, regardless of their extent. Ground Remediation
Ground or land remediation is a process that involves the removal and restoration of groundwater or polluted soil. The requirement for ground remediation arises in areas where the soil or groundwater has been contaminated by pollutants, including industrial chemicals, heavy metals or pesticides. The primary objective of ground remediation is to lower the levels of pollutants to a safe level, thus rendering the land usable again. Ground remediation can be executed through diverse techniques, such as bioremediation, soil washing and excavation. The level and type of contamination, together with the site conditions will determine which method is used. Land remediation is a challenging and time-intensive process that demands specialized tools and expertise. Partnering with industry experts is vital for ensuring the remediation procedure is conducted safely and effectively. To summarize, ground remediation is a crucial procedure for restoring polluted land, and it necessitates selecting the right method for each distinct case and collaborating with seasoned professionals to ensure safety and efficiency.
Asbestos Air Monitoring Sandiway
The safety of air quality in environments that could potentially be contaminated with airborne asbestos fibres is assessed and ensured through an extensive procedure known as asbestos air monitoring. The air is sampled and analysed systematically for the presence of these harmful fibres. The goal is to measure the level of airborne asbestos fibres and to determine whether they pose a threat to the health of employees, occupants or residents.

Air monitoring is performed using specialised equipment by certified asbestos professionals. Air sampling devices are strategically placed by them in areas where asbestos disturbance or removal is taking place. These devices collect air samples over a set period. After collection, the samples are analysed in certified laboratories to determine the quantity and type of asbestos fibres present.
Air monitoring cannot be overstated in its significance, serving several critical purposes:
- Risk Assessment: Asbestos air monitoring is used to determine the level of asbestos exposure risk during activities such as asbestos maintenance, removal or renovation. Protective measures can be tailored to the specific needs of the situation, thanks to informed decision-making that is enabled by this.
- Regulatory Compliance: Asbestos management regulations are strict in many countries, including the UK, and asbestos air monitoring is a critical tool for ensuring compliance with this legislation and for documenting the safety measures taken.
- Worker Safety: To protect themselves from exposure to asbestos, individuals involved in asbestos-related work, such as asbestos removal contractors, maintenance staff, and construction workers, should use air monitoring to obtain real-time data on the effectiveness of containment measures and the need for personal protective equipment.
- Public Health: The small size of asbestos fibres allows them to travel through the air, possibly spreading beyond the work area to neighbouring homes and buildings or even people walking by. To protect the adjoining community from inhaling these hazardous fibres, air monitoring is essential.
- Verification of Abatement: After asbestos removal or control measures have been implemented, air monitoring is generally carried out to confirm that the area is safe for reoccupation. This prevents potential exposure to any asbestos fibres that are still hanging around.
Conclusion: Asbestos air monitoring acts as a critical safeguard against the health risks posed by asbestos exposure. By offering precise information on airborne asbestos fibre levels, it facilitates timely interventions, protects worker and public health, and ensures adherence to regulations. Diseases caused by asbestos exposure have a long latency period, often taking decades to show symptoms. Hence, adopting proactive asbestos air monitoring is vital to preventing future health crises and protecting people living and working in areas where asbestos could be hazardous.
